Original Description
"Geranium On A Windowsill" by Miriam Ramsay Holland captures the quiet poetry of domestic life through an intimate still-life study. Painted with keen sensitivity to light and texture, this early 20th-century work showcases Holland's mastery of Post-Impressionist techniques while retaining distinctly British restraint. The composition frames a single terracotta pot of scarlet geraniums against a sunlit window, its brushwork alternating between delicate botanical precision and expressive, painterly strokes in the rendered foliage. As part of the British interiors revival movement (1890-1930), the artwork bridges traditional still-life conventions with emerging modern sensibilities, particularly in its treatment of reflected light on glass and ceramic surfaces. Historically significant for documenting urban horticultural practices during the interwar period, Holland's work gained recognition for elevating mundane household subjects to contemplative aesthetic experiences, influencing later mid-century botanical illustrators.
